SOURCE: How to replace 2004 Hyundai Elantra starter

First, disconnect the battery. Then the only part that needs to be removed to access the starter is the rubber air plenum boot between the throttle body and the air filter housing. This allows enough room to get an arm in there to access the 14mm bolts that attach the starter to the transmission. After removing the bolts, the starter can be removed from underneath the car. lower it down as much as possible, and unbolt the power cable. You may have to twist and turn it a bit to get around the support between the engine block and intake manifold, but it will come out.

SOURCE: Correct torque on cylinder head bolts for Hyundai Elantra 1.8GLS

You have two bolt sizes the shorter or smaller of the two sizes is called M10 the torque is 22ft lbs +65 degrees +65 degrees again The larger of the two bolts is called a M12 the torque for these are 26ft lbs +65+65. There is a tightening order staring at the top center bolt and working in a circle They have to be torqued in three steps. Where is the 2000 hyundai starter located?

Use the jack to lift up the front of the Elantra and place the car on the jack stands. Double-check that the Elantra is secure on the jack stands prior to working underneath the car.

  • 2 Disconnect the negative and positive terminals from the battery using the open-end wrench, removing the negative first, then the positive.
  • 3 Slide under the Elantra and unbolt the engine cover on the underside of the vehicle using the 3/8-inch ratchet and socket. Remove it and place it out of the way.
  • 4 Locate the starter motor, which is on the passenger side of the engine, connected to the transmission. Remove all wiring from the starter using the an open-end wrench or the ratchet, depending on clearance for tools.
  • 5 Unbolt the starter using the 3/8-inch ratchet, extension and socket, being careful to hold it steady with one hand while undoing the last bolt. The starter is quite heavy.

    Where is thermostat for radiator on 2003 Hyundai elantra

    Its is located exactly where the lower radiator hose connects to the engine.To remove the thermostat we have to remove the air filter housing . The thermostat is held in position by means of two bolts.
